Types of Front Doors
When thinking about an upgrade, several kinds of doors are offered, each boasting distinct materials, styles, and performances. Below is a breakdown of some common door types:
Type of Door | Material Options |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Wood Doors | Solid wood, engineered wood | Traditional aesthetic, customizable | Prone to warping, greater upkeep |
Fiberglass Doors | Fiberglass composite | Energy-efficient, resilient, and appears like wood | Can be more expensive than steel |
Steel Doors | Galvanized steel | Outstanding security, low maintenance | May be susceptible to rust if scratched |
Composite Doors | Mixture of products | Extremely adjustable, energy-efficient | Can be expensive; quality varies |
Glass Doors | Tempered glass with frame | Modern and stylish, allows natural light | Less personal privacy and can be less protected |
Which Door is Right for You?
Choosing the right front door includes considering a number of elements, including your home's style, your spending plan, and the desired level of security. Here are some suggestions for making the ideal choice:
- Assess Your Home's Style: Match the door design with your home's architectural details. For example, a Victorian home may gain from an elaborate wood door, while a modern home might look excellent with a sleek, minimalist style.
- Determine Your Budget: Front door costs can differ widely depending on materials and workmanship. Set Front Door Replacement Cost that accommodates both the door and installation costs.
- Evaluate Security Needs: If security is a primary concern, consider doors made from steel or strengthened materials. Advanced locking systems can likewise enhance security.
- Think About Energy Efficiency: Look for doors that have been Energy Star ranked for optimum insulation and energy conservation.
- Aspect in Maintenance: Consider just how much time and effort you are willing to dedicate to upkeep. Some materials, such as wood, may need regular painting or staining, while fiberglass and steel need less upkeep.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How much does a front door upgrade cost?
A: The cost of updating a front door can range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 5,000, depending on the material, style, and labor costs. High-end doors with custom features and professional installation will be on the higher end of the spectrum.
Q2: How long does it take to install a new front door?
A: Generally, the installation process can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ending upon the complexity of the task and whether any structural changes are required.
Q3: Can I install a front door myself?
A: While it is possible for skilled DIY lovers to install a front door themselves, it is advised to work with specialists to make sure that the door is appropriately fitted and sealed for energy effectiveness.
Q4: What are the best materials for a front door?
A: That largely depends upon specific preferences. Steel and fiberglass doors offer exceptional security and insulation, while solid wood doors offer unequaled aesthetic appeal.
Q5: Do I need a permit for a front door replacement?
A: Permitting requirements vary by place. It is advisable to check with local building authorities to identify if an authorization is required for door replacement.
